Andrea B.
Thomas is an Independent Director at Medifast, Inc., a Director at Children's Miracle Network, and a Professor at David Eccles School of Business.
She previously worked as a Director at WesTech Engineering, Inc., a Director at Sustainability Consortium, a Vice President at The Hershey Co., and a Senior Vice President at Walmart, Inc. Ms. Thomas has an undergraduate degree from the University of Utah and an MBA from Brigham Young University.
